DW Spectrum Desktop Client Crash on Windows

Issue Description
Some users on Windows 10 and Windows 11 are experiencing issues with the DW Spectrum Desktop Client, including crashes or the application not opening. These problems often occur shortly after launching the Client or when working with layouts that include multiple items. In some cases, users have also reported memory leaks or slow performance.

Cause of the Issue
The underlying issue is related to OpenGL support. Many modern graphics drivers, especially those for Intel integrated GPUs and some NVIDIA GPUs do not fully support OpenGL on Windows. As a result, the default graphics rendering option used by the DW Spectrum Desktop Client (OpenGL) can lead to crashes and instability.
Short Term Solutions
Force the Client to Use DirectX
- Close the DW Spectrum Client.
- Open the File Explorer and navigate to:
C://Users/<username>/AppData/Local/
- Create a file directory folder called “nx_ini”, if it does not already exist.
- Create a blank .ini file called “desktop_client.ini”.
- Open a text editor (e.g., Notepad).
- Use Save As and name the file “desktop_client.ini”
- Save the file in the directory:
C://Users/<username>/AppData/Local/nx_ini/
- Start the DW Spectrum Desktop Client once, it should generate all default values for this file. Close the Client before proceeding.
- Open the desktop_client.ini file with a text editor (e.g., Notepad).
- Add or change the following line, and save your changes:
graphicsApi=”direct3d11”
- After launching the Client, you can verify that the graphics API has changed in the About (F1) window of the DW Spectrum Client.
Downgrade to a Stable NVIDIA Driver If Using OpenGL
You may want to consider installing NVIDIA driver version 32.0.15.5639, which has been tested and is known to work reliably in many cases. However, results can vary depending on the specific hardware configuration of your system.
Long Term Solution
Starting from DW Spectrum version 6.1, the DW Spectrum Client uses a new Rendering Hardware Interface (RHI) that supports multiple graphics API backends. This allows the DW Spectrum Client to automatically use the most suitable rendering options for your system:
- Direct3D – default on Windows
- Metal – MacOS
- Vulkan – default on Linux if supported by the graphics card
- OpenGL (modern) – used on Linux when Vulkan is not available
